M.K. Vernon is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Hardware and Architecture and Computational Theory and Mathematics. According to data from OpenAlex, M.K. Vernon has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 543 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Computer Networks and Communications, 10 papers in Hardware and Architecture and 4 papers in Computational Theory and Mathematics. Recurrent topics in M.K. Vernon’s work include Parallel Computing and Optimization Techniques (9 papers), Distributed systems and fault tolerance (7 papers) and Interconnection Networks and Systems (6 papers). M.K. Vernon is often cited by papers focused on Parallel Computing and Optimization Techniques (9 papers), Distributed systems and fault tolerance (7 papers) and Interconnection Networks and Systems (6 papers). M.K. Vernon coll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and Brazil. M.K. Vernon's co-authors include Mark A. Holliday, Derek L. Eager, John Zahorjan, Vikram Adve, Edward D. Lazowska, Scott T. Leutenegger, Aniket Mahanti, Jussara M. Almeida, Stephen J. Wright and Umakishore Ramachandran and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Transactions on Software Engineering, IEEE Transactions on Knowledge and Data Engineering and IEEE/ACM Transactions on Networking.
